PDA

View Full Version : سوال: تبديل پروژه از نسخه 2010 به 2008



kingmax
پنج شنبه 09 تیر 1390, 19:06 عصر
چگونه می توان کدهای نوشته شده در ویژوال 2010 را در ویژوال 2008 نوشت.

aghayex
پنج شنبه 09 تیر 1390, 20:04 عصر
شما نمی تونید یه پروِِژه 2010 رو در 2008 فراخوانی کنید و فقط می تونید با برنامه نوت پد فایل های با پسوند cs که کد ها در اون هست رو نگاه کنی

bnnoor
پنج شنبه 09 تیر 1390, 20:51 عصر
چگونه می توان کدهای نوشته شده در ویژوال 2010 را در ویژوال 2008 نوشت.

اگر در ساخت پروژه از فریم ورک 4 استفاده نکرده باشید امکانش هست . ( البته به دلایلی ممکنه روش زیر هم جوان نده )
یکی از دلایلی که باعث میشه پروژه 2010 شما با ویزوال 2008 باز نشه امضای موجود در پروژه هست . شما میتونید با یک ترفند امضا رو به ویژوال 2008 تغییر بدید....

روش کار بصورت انگلیسی رو از سایت پشتیبان ویژوال میزارم فهمیدم راحته اگر مشکلی داشتید بپرسید ...

1.1. If under source control, check out the solution file only (source control explorer not from solution explorer).
2. Open your VS 2010 .sln in notepad.
It should look something like this:
Microsoft Visual Studio Solution File, Format Version 11.00 # Visual Studio 2010 Project("{FAE04EC0-3 ...... ...........................
3. Change the Version 11.0 to Version 10.0 and Visual Studio 2010 to 2008
It should look something like this:
Microsoft Visual Studio Solution File, Format Version 10.00 # Visual Studio 2008 Project("{FAE04EC0-3 ..... ..........................
4. Save the file.
5. Open in vs 2008 all projects should load, compile etc.
5.5. After making sure it all works, you can check it in. Don't forget to run unit tests :)

kingmax
جمعه 10 تیر 1390, 10:36 صبح
ممنون میشه واضح تر توضیح بدی

bnnoor
جمعه 10 تیر 1390, 11:07 صبح
فایل پروژه پا فرمت Sln رو با برنامه Notepad باز کنید.
این عبارت رو توش پیدا کنید :
Microsoft Visual Studio Solution File, Format Version 11.00 # Visual Studio 2010 Project("{FAE04EC0-3 ......
و به جاش این رو قرار بدید :
Microsoft Visual Studio Solution File, Format Version 10.00 # Visual Studio 2008 Project("{FAE04EC0-3 .....
و بعد فایل رو ذخیره کنید
در ضمن فراموش نکنید که از قبل از فایلتون که کپی تهیه کنید تا اگر در اجرای پروژه مشکلی پیش اومد بتونید به حالت قبل برش گردونید .

rezgar_roshan
چهارشنبه 29 خرداد 1392, 23:38 عصر
ممنون دستت درد نکنه استفاده کردم. خیلی به جا بود.

cisco ++
چهارشنبه 19 تیر 1392, 19:19 عصر
فایل پروژه پا فرمت Sln رو با برنامه Notepad باز کنید.
این عبارت رو توش پیدا کنید :
Microsoft Visual Studio Solution File, Format Version 11.00 # Visual Studio 2010 Project("{FAE04EC0-3 ......
و به جاش این رو قرار بدید :
Microsoft Visual Studio Solution File, Format Version 10.00 # Visual Studio 2008 Project("{FAE04EC0-3 .....
و بعد فایل رو ذخیره کنید
در ضمن فراموش نکنید که از قبل از فایلتون که کپی تهیه کنید تا اگر در اجرای پروژه مشکلی پیش اومد بتونید به حالت قبل برش گردونید .

ممنون از راهنمایی مفیدتون. کالا به دردم خورد

volkswagen
دوشنبه 13 آبان 1392, 22:11 عصر
من فایل رو باز کردم ولی اینا داخلش بود:



Microsoft Visual Studio Solution File, Format Version 11.00
# Visual Studio 2010
Project("{F184B08F-C81C-45F6-A57F-5ABD9991F28F}") = "test1", "test1\test1.vbproj", "{38C14119-0F09-4945-A22A-C2AF2E1696FF}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|x86 = Debug|x86
Release|x86 = Release|x86
EndGlobalSection
GlobalSection(ProjectConfigurationPlatforms) = postSolution
{38C14119-0F09-4945-A22A-C2AF2E1696FF}.Debug|x86.ActiveCfg = Debug|x86
{38C14119-0F09-4945-A22A-C2AF2E1696FF}.Debug|x86.Build.0 = Debug|x86
{38C14119-0F09-4945-A22A-C2AF2E1696FF}.Release|x86.ActiveCfg = Release|x86
{38C14119-0F09-4945-A22A-C2AF2E1696FF}.Release|x86.Build.0 = Release|x86
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
EndGlobalSection
EndGlobal

xxnagin
دوشنبه 13 آبان 1392, 22:53 عصر
سلام
درست گفته مگه قراره چیزه دیگه ای باشه
همون خط دوم که بالا # Visual Studio 2010
نوشته به جاش 2008 بذار
دوستمون خط 1و2و3 رو توی یه خط نوشتن

nazi89
دوشنبه 16 دی 1392, 14:31 عصر
اگه بخوام از وژن 2008 به 2010 تبدیل کنم چی کار کنم لطفا راهنماییم کنید :متفکر:

vb341
دوشنبه 16 دی 1392, 18:21 عصر
برای تبدیل به 2010 فقط کافیه پروژه رو با 2010 باز کنی

barnamenevisjavan
دوشنبه 16 دی 1392, 21:29 عصر
برای تبدیل ویژوال بالا به پایین مثلا 2012 به 2010 و...
کافیه فایل پروژه رو با نوتپد باز کنید و این دو گزینه رو تغییر بدید
Format Version 10.00
Visual Studio 2010

برای 2012
Format Version 12.00
Visual Studio 2012

و مابقی هم به همین صورت
بعدش ذخیره کنید
اگر پروژه بازم باز نشد روی فایل پروژه راست کلیک و از طریق Open With پروژه رو در ویژوال باز کنید.

nazi89
پنج شنبه 19 دی 1392, 08:21 صبح
مرسی از راهنماییتون . (من تازه میخوام با C# و vs کار کنم زیاد بلد نیستم :ناراحت:)
ولی برنامه را بار اول که میخواستم بازکنم پیغام داد که نت فرام ورکش 3.5 ولی میدونین که vs2010 نت فرام ورکش 4 .
حالا هم باز میکنم چند خط دستور داره و وقتی run میزنم خطا میده میشه کاریش کرد

barnamenevisjavan
پنج شنبه 19 دی 1392, 10:29 صبح
مرسی از راهنماییتون . (من تازه میخوام با C# و vs کار کنم زیاد بلد نیستم :ناراحت:)
ولی برنامه را بار اول که میخواستم بازکنم پیغام داد که نت فرام ورکش 3.5 ولی میدونین که vs2010 نت فرام ورکش 4 .
حالا هم باز میکنم چند خط دستور داره و وقتی run میزنم خطا میده میشه کاریش کرد

هیچ مشکلی بوجود نمیاد VS خودش نت 3.5 رو تبدیل میزنه به 4
ولی اگر باز مشکل دارید Net Framwork 3.5 sp1 رو نصب کنید بسته های دات نت 2 و 3 و 3.5 هم به VS اضافه میشه و خطایی هم نمیده

sajad2852
دوشنبه 22 اردیبهشت 1393, 14:46 عصر
بسیاااااااااااااااااااااا ااااااااااااااااااااااااا ر بسیــــــــــــــــــــــ ـــــــــــــــــــار ممنونم
واقعا دستتون رو میبوسم از دور
من پروژم رو با 2012 نوشتم و میخاستم از کریستال ریپورت استفاده کنم اما نسخه 2012 گیر نیاوردم
و مجبور شدم که نسخه رو عوض کنم .عوض کردم برنامم اجرا نشد
اما با راهنمایی شما برناممو اجرا کردم
واقعا احسنت به برنامه نویسان ایرانی:تشویق::تشویق::تشویق:: شویق:

leilaasadi
سه شنبه 12 دی 1396, 22:55 عصر
خیلی خیلی ممنون. خیلی کارمو راه انداختید خدا اجرتون بده:تشویق: